Cards markets are quietly one of the most useful angles in football betting. They move on their own logic, largely independent of the result, which means a single fixture can offer value on the cards line even when the match-result and total-goals prices look flat. Our tables show yellow and red card counts plus booking points per game for every team across 27 leagues, with the Betfred scoring of 10 points per yellow and 25 points per red so the numbers line up directly with the bookmaker's settled markets.
Read the booking-points column first. A side averaging 22 or more booking points per game is consistently picking up two yellows and the odd red, usually a combination of an aggressive press, a settled physical centre-back and a midfielder who likes to commit tactical fouls. Anything below 14 is a clean, technical side or, more often, one whose referee selection has run hot with whistle-shy officials. The full yellow and red breakdown beside the totals lets you separate the genuinely physical teams from the unlucky ones.
Always cross-check the named referee for the fixture. Two of the same physical sides can produce very different card counts depending on who is officiating, which is why we publish a full Referee Stats page alongside this one.
